Web9 de fev. de 2024 · Plan to spend approximately 3X the time of in-classroom instruction on studying while in graduate school. A normal course load of 9-12 credits per semester equates to 27-36 hours of graduate school study time per week. There are many variables, however, that can change your graduate school study schedule. Extended Stay America – directly across the street from us. The rate I was … philip leacock directorWebYou might have heard that the ratio of classroom time to study time should be 1:2 or 1:3. This would mean that for every hour you spend in class, you should plan to spend two to three hours out of class working independently on course assignments.
